I have not experienced the same behavior in my own Quicken after recent updates. I have some follow-up questions that will hopefully help us to narrow down what could be happening here.
- How are you opening Quicken?
- Are you using the red square application icon, or a more rectangular icon that looks like a sheet of paper with the corner folded down?
- Where is your data file located?
- You can see this by going to File. The first file listed at the bottom of the menu shows the file location.
- The default location for a Quicken data file is C:>Users>username>Documents>Quicken, and this is where we recommend keeping it.
- You can see this by going to File. The first file listed at the bottom of the menu shows the file location.
- Is your data file being synced/backed up by any third-party services like OneDrive, Dropbox, or Blackblaze?
- We do not recommend allowing services like this to access the data file you are actively using, as it can damage the file.
- Approximately how long do you think this issue has been happening?
- Restoring a backup could be a viable troubleshooting option if it hasn't been more than 2-3 months.
